To solve the collision dilemma of your Bathroom Door Ideas, consider the “double-mini swing” approach.
By installing two narrow doors that swing inward, similar to French doors but sized for a small water closet, you can easily step inside and close them without hitting the main bathroom door. This provides a much more solid and private feel than a bifold or accordion door, which can be noisy and difficult to operate from the inside.
The ultimate solution for a bathroom right off a public space, like a dining room, is a solid-core, out-swing door. While an out-swing might not be your first choice, a solid-core door provides the best sound insulation vital for blocking out “grandpa’s diarrhea” sounds while guests are at the table, and it preserves every inch of valuable floor space inside a small bathroom.
Use hinge-pin door stops to prevent the door from hitting cabinets or light switches, and ensure the hinges are placed so the door opens toward a wall or cabinet rather than into a high-traffic path. 15. Classic Panel Wooden Door

Classic wooden bathroom door ideas never go out of style. A simple panel door adds warmth and elegance while keeping privacy at its best. You can paint it white for a clean look, or choose natural wood tones for a cozy feeling. This option works beautifully in traditional and modern homes alike. Solid wood or engineered wood designs are durable and long-lasting, especially when sealed properly to resist moisture. If you want timeless bathroom door ideas that blend with any décor, this is a safe and stylish choice.
14. Frosted Glass Door

Frosted glass bathroom door ideas are perfect for those who want light without losing privacy. The blurred effect allows brightness to pass through while keeping the interior hidden. This is ideal for bathrooms located in darker hallways. Frosted glass designs can look sleek and modern, especially with black or silver frames. These bathroom door ideas create an airy atmosphere and make small bathrooms feel more open. They are easy to clean and resistant to humidity, making them both practical and beautiful.
13. Sliding Barn Door

Sliding barn bathroom door ideas bring charm and character to any home. Mounted on an external track, this door slides smoothly along the wall, saving valuable floor space. It works especially well in small bathrooms where swing doors take up too much room. You can choose rustic wood for a farmhouse feel or painted designs for a modern twist. These bathroom door ideas are stylish, functional, and visually striking, turning an ordinary bathroom entrance into a design feature.
12. Pocket Door

Pocket bathroom door ideas are excellent space-saving solutions. This door slides directly into the wall, completely disappearing when open. It is perfect for compact bathrooms or en-suite designs where every inch matters. Pocket doors provide a clean, minimalist look and reduce clutter. These bathroom door ideas are practical and modern, offering smooth operation and full functionality without blocking walkways. If you want efficiency and style combined, this option is a smart investment.

10. Mirrored Door

Mirrored bathroom door ideas are practical and visually smart. A full-length mirror attached to the door saves wall space and makes the bathroom appear larger. This is especially useful in small apartments. These bathroom door ideas combine function and style effortlessly. You get a dressing mirror and a door in one design. Choose moisture-resistant backing to ensure durability. It is a clever way to enhance both space and convenience.
9. Louvered Door

Louvered bathroom door ideas are great for ventilation. The horizontal slats allow air circulation, helping reduce humidity and prevent mold buildup. This is especially helpful in bathrooms without windows. Painted white, these doors give a coastal or cottage vibe. These bathroom door ideas balance airflow and privacy effectively. They are lightweight, stylish, and practical for maintaining a fresh bathroom environment.

7. PVC Waterproof Door

PVC bathroom door ideas are affordable, lightweight, and water-resistant. They are perfect for high-moisture areas and require very little maintenance. Available in many colors and patterns, PVC doors can mimic wood or modern finishes. These bathroom door ideas are ideal for budget-friendly renovations without compromising on durability. Easy installation and simple cleaning make them a practical everyday solution.

1. Smart Glass Door

Smart glass bathroom door ideas represent modern innovation. With adjustable transparency, the glass can switch from clear to opaque for privacy. This high-tech solution adds luxury and uniqueness. These bathroom door ideas are perfect for upscale homes seeking advanced features and sleek aesthetics. They combine privacy, light control, and style in one impressive design.
